Peregrine Rivière has spent most of his career in the investor relations space, and the passion that he feels towards his work (and towards the business world in general) is unwavering. In fact, he’s sure he has the best job in the world! The day that this episode was recorded was Peregrine’s last day as the Director of Investor Relations for WPP, and he is looking forward to his new journey as the Head of Investor Relations at the London Stock Exchange. Tune in today to hear about Peregrine’s transition from accounting and investor research to investor relations, the project that won him the Best Innovation in Investor Relations Award, the importance of flexibility and “paying it forward” in the investor relations space, advice for staying on top of investor relations trends, and more.
